Why I am making this film and how you can help

February 24, 2011 in Uncategorized by Herman Munster - Site Admin

Since the 1980′s I’ve loved many aspects of the Goth scene – the music, the fashions, the art and the people. But, Goths have been very much misunderstood and demonized in popular culture, especially since the Columbine Massacre.

I’m making a film to counter all of the negative stereotypes and show that Goths are good people and mostly happy people who contribute to the world in positive way, have jobs, families, and lives. Goth is not just a fad, as it has passed the torch onto several generations now and has no sign of stopping. Help me get this film made and show the world that Goths are not evil people who shoot up schools, but we are a wonderful, lovely and lovable, peaceful creative bunch!

The project is a feature-length documentary (Gothumenatry) film on the Goth subculture world-wide (if I can get the funding to travel, otherwise it will only contain the footage I have now). Filming has already been done to in Toronto, Montreal and via video contributions from Goths in parts of the USA.

The film features interviews with (these interviews have been shot):

Edward Ka-Spel of the Legendary Pink Dots, Baron Marcus of the Vampire Beach Babes, Nancy Kilpatrick author of The Goth Bible, Lance Goth (the past owner of Sanctuary Vampire Sex Bar, The Catacombs, The Vatikan), The Westborough Baptist Church, Noah Korda from Bats Day in the Fun Park (audio only), Michael Ratt (of The Dark Place Gothic Society, healer and musician), Nik Beat (poet, musician, broadcaster), Stella Sanders the designer of S.I.N.S. Gothic Punk Fashions, Mitch Kroll (Beyond the Gates of Hell radio show, the band Masochistic Religion), members of the Goth scene world-wide, the band Freakency, Cad Gold Jr., photographer Hugues LeBlanc, DJ Todd (ex-Sanctuary Vampire Sex Bar DJ and Internet broadcaster with synthetic.org), Jo Kuczynska of Fluffer Designs, Veronique Chevalier AKA The “Weird Val” of Cabaret, author Liz Worth (“Treat Me Like Dirt”), and lots more!

I have plans for extended DVDs that will feature full interviews with interesting people that had to be cut for the film, musical performances and neat things like graveyard tours that I have on video!

Also, I have plans to release the uncut, full interviews and footage from the film. These many hours of footage will be available to subscribers.

Earthquake in Toronto today!

June 23, 2010 in Uncategorized by Herman Munster - Site Admin

I felt that earthquake a few minutes ago! I was working in the basement and felt my chair shaking. There was no noise. Having been in an earthquake before, I knew what it felt like. My immediate thought was -”Earthquake?!” Wild to experience that here in the west end of Toronto. I felt no aftershock. Interesting to see Twitter aflame with the news right away!

My first earthquake was in Vancouver a few years back. I was several floors up and I felt the floor swaying and heard some shaking.
